Output 43c1739258f9873a654c0e4f0bbc5099cfd759332903c77045e3854ae4ad02c0:111

value
40406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586761dd19b472b879860285c9c4a95a7fd932d5 OP_EQUAL
address
39kTEYwjyrAapC1LE5SJcRLTWStFuqAh8A
transaction
43c1739258f9873a654c0e4f0bbc5099cfd759332903c77045e3854ae4ad02c0